This artwork is a remastered and enhanced reproduction of an early steamship portrait titled “City of Macon.” The reproduction is based on a copy of the original oil painting inspired by Antonio Jacobsen, a prolific, late 1800s and early 1900s, nautical art painter. This American steamship was built in the late 19th century for the Ocean Steamship Company of Savannah, Georgia (often referred to as the “Savannah Line”). It was launched in 1885 and was one of several “City” ships in the Savannah Line, which also included vessels such as the City of Savannah, City of Augusta, and City of Columbus. These steamers provided passenger and freight service between New York City and southern ports, primarily Savannah, Georgia. The City of Macon’s design was like other transitional steamships of the era. This design meant the ship was equipped and rigged with auxiliary sails (as shown in the painting) in addition to her steam-powered engine. This hybrid design was typical in the 1880s, when steam power was reliable but sails were still used for efficiency and as backup. The City of Macon regularly carried passengers, mail, and cotton cargo between New York and Savannah, strengthening commercial ties between the northeastern United States and the South. She remained in service into the early 20th century before being retired as steel-hulled steamers replaced the older iron and composite vessels.
